Ingredients Breakdown
Let’s take a closer look at the ingredients that make this banana bread so special. Here’s what you’ll need:
- 1 box of yellow cake mix: This is the star of the show! It provides the base for our lovely loaf.
- 3 ripe bananas, mashed: The riper the bananas, the sweeter your bread will be! Look for bananas that are speckled and fragrant.
- 2 large eggs: These will bind everything together, adding richness and moisture.
- 1/3 cup vegetable oil: A small amount of oil keeps the bread tender.
- 1/2 cup water: This helps create the right batter consistency.
- 1/2 cup chopped walnuts or chocolate chips (optional): Add these for a delightful crunch or a burst of sweetness.

How to Make Cake Mix Pudding Banana Bread
Now that we have our ingredients ready, let’s jump into the step-by-step process of bringing this lovely creation to life!
Step 1: Preheat Oven to 350°F
Start by preheating your oven to 350°F (175°C). This ensures that your banana bread bakes evenly and beautifully.
Step 2: Mix Dry Ingredients Thoroughly
In a large mixing bowl, combine the yellow cake mix and any dry ingredients you’re using (like cinnamon, if desired). Give it a gentle whisk to blend everything together.
Step 3: Add Mashed Bananas Evenly
Next, fold in the mashed ripe bananas. This is where the magic starts to happen! The bananas add natural sweetness and moisture.
Step 4: Fold in Wet Ingredients
Now, add the eggs, vegetable oil, and water. Mix gently until just combined to avoid over-mixing, which can lead to a denser bread.
Step 5: Pour Batter Into Loaf Pan
Grease a loaf pan with cooking spray or butter. Pour your batter into the prepared pan, smoothing the top with a spatula. If you’re adding optional chocolate chips or nuts, sprinkle them on top!

Common Mistakes and Troubleshooting
Even the best bakers make mistakes! Here are some common pitfalls and how to avoid them:
- Dense bread: This can happen if you over-mix the batter. Mix until just combined.
- Dry texture: Ensure you’re measuring your ingredients accurately, especially the flour.
- Burnt edges: If your bread browns too quickly, cover it with aluminum foil during the last 15 minutes of baking.
- Raw center: If the outside is browning too much, reduce the oven temperature slightly and bake longer.

Storage and Make-Ahead Instructions
Want to prepare ahead? No problem! Here’s how to store your banana bread:
- Room temperature: Store the cooled bread wrapped in plastic wrap at room temperature for up to 3 days.
- Refrigerate: For longer storage, refrigerate for up to a week.
- Freeze: Wrap tightly in aluminum foil or freezer bags and freeze for up to 3 months. Thaw overnight in the refrigerator when you’re ready to indulge!
